40 max. Reporting to the Vice President of Professional and General Services, this position is responsible for the overall direction of the Environmental Services department. The director has oversight and responsibility for all financial, managerial, strategic, and clinical objectives. The director ensures staff development, performance, and competence, staffing patterns, performance improvement, capital and operating budgeting, and internal and external marketing and communication for the department. This position is accountable to county, state, and federal agencies in addition to other external regulatory agencies for maintaining compliance with applicable laws, regulations, and standards. Ability to meet all job physical requirements as outlined in job description or as agreed through a work place accommodation.
EDUCATION/TRAINING/ EXPERIENCE
Three years of experience in healthcare environmental services with management with increasing supervisory experience. Bi-lingual (Spanish English) speaking, reading, and writing desired. Training and knowledge of environmental control practices and procedures. Bachelor's degree in business administration, healthcare administration, or related field desired: master's degree preferred.
Knowledgeable in regulatory requirements:
federal, state, Title XXII, The Joint Commission, and California Department of Public Health.
